public String getDomainName(){ User user = (User) ActionContext.getContext().getValueStack().peek(); return domainService.findDomainById(user.getDomainId()).getName(); }
@Override public Map<String, Network> get() { User currentUser = currentUserSupplier.get(); NetworkClient networkClient = client.getNetworkClient(); return Maps.uniqueIndex( networkClient.listNetworks(accountInDomain(currentUser.getAccount(), currentUser.getDomainId())), new Function<Network, String>() { @Override public String apply(Network arg0) { return arg0.getId(); } }); } }
@Override public Map<String, Network> get() { User currentUser = currentUserSupplier.get(); NetworkClient networkClient = client.getNetworkClient(); return Maps.uniqueIndex( networkClient.listNetworks(accountInDomain(currentUser.getAccount(), currentUser.getDomainId())), new Function<Network, String>() { @Override public String apply(Network arg0) { return arg0.getId(); } }); } }
@Override public Map<String, Project> get() { User currentUser = currentUserSupplier.get(); ProjectApi projectApi = api.getProjectApi(); return Maps.uniqueIndex( projectApi.listProjects(accountInDomain(currentUser.getAccount(), currentUser.getDomainId())), new Function<Project, String>() { @Override public String apply(Project arg0) { return arg0.getId(); } }); } }
@Override public Map<String, Network> get() { User currentUser = currentUserSupplier.get(); NetworkApi networkClient = client.getNetworkApi(); return Maps.uniqueIndex( networkClient.listNetworks(accountInDomain(currentUser.getAccount(), currentUser.getDomainId())), new Function<Network, String>() { @Override public String apply(Network arg0) { return arg0.getId(); } }); } }
@Test public void testListNetworks() throws Exception { if (!networksSupported) return; Set<Network> response = client.getNetworkClient().listNetworks( accountInDomain(user.getAccount(), user.getDomainId())); assert null != response; long networkCount = response.size(); assertTrue(networkCount >= 0); for (Network network : response) { Network newDetails = getOnlyElement(client.getNetworkClient().listNetworks(id(network.getId()))); assertEquals(network, newDetails); assertEquals(network, client.getNetworkClient().getNetwork(network.getId())); checkNetwork(network); } }
@Test public void testListNetworks() throws Exception { if (!networksSupported) return; Set<Network> response = client.getNetworkApi().listNetworks( accountInDomain(user.getAccount(), user.getDomainId())); assert null != response; long networkCount = response.size(); assertTrue(networkCount >= 0); for (Network network : response) { Network newDetails = getOnlyElement(client.getNetworkApi().listNetworks(id(network.getId()))); assertEquals(network, newDetails); assertEquals(network, client.getNetworkApi().getNetwork(network.getId())); checkNetwork(network); } }
.accountInDomain(user.getAccount(), user.getDomainId()) .forVirtualNetwork(true) .vlan(1001)
.accountInDomain(user.getAccount(), user.getDomainId()) .forVirtualNetwork(true) .vlan(1001)
public T fromUser(User in) { return this .id(in.getId()) .name(in.getName()) .firstName(in.getFirstName()) .lastName(in.getLastName()) .email(in.getEmail()) .created(in.getCreated()) .state(in.getState()) .account(in.getAccount()) .accountType(in.getAccountType()) .domain(in.getDomain()) .domainId(in.getDomainId()) .timeZone(in.getTimeZone()) .apiKey(in.getApiKey()) .secretKey(in.getSecretKey()); } }
public T fromUser(User in) { return this .id(in.getId()) .name(in.getName()) .firstName(in.getFirstName()) .lastName(in.getLastName()) .email(in.getEmail()) .created(in.getCreated()) .state(in.getState()) .account(in.getAccount()) .accountType(in.getAccountType()) .domain(in.getDomain()) .domainId(in.getDomainId()) .timeZone(in.getTimeZone()) .apiKey(in.getApiKey()) .secretKey(in.getSecretKey()); } }
public T fromUser(User in) { return this .id(in.getId()) .name(in.getName()) .firstName(in.getFirstName()) .lastName(in.getLastName()) .email(in.getEmail()) .created(in.getCreated()) .state(in.getState()) .account(in.getAccount()) .accountType(in.getAccountType()) .domain(in.getDomain()) .domainId(in.getDomainId()) .timeZone(in.getTimeZone()) .apiKey(in.getApiKey()) .secretKey(in.getSecretKey()); } }
assert user.getAccountType().equals(account.getType()) : user; assert user.getDomain().equals(account.getDomain()) : user; assert user.getDomainId().equals(account.getDomainId()) : user; assert user.getCreated() != null : user; assert user.getEmail() != null : user;
assert user.getAccountType().equals(account.getType()) : user; assert user.getDomain().equals(account.getDomain()) : user; assert user.getDomainId().equals(account.getDomainId()) : user; assert user.getCreated() != null : user; assert user.getEmail() != null : user;